The Q7 recently got facelifted.
The 2019 had a 4-cylinder option that started low 50s.
The 2020 is currently only available with the V6, hence the "starting price" of low 60s. When the 2020 becomes available with the 4-cylinder later this year the starting price will drop to low 50s.
